Webinar – Launch of 50+ Report “Connections and Community”

Watch the launch of our 2021 50+ report "Connections and Community", which looks at older people's connection to their community. The report dispels the myth of the scared and lonely elderly person, and also highlights the importance of volunteering.

Webinar – Managing Energy Costs

This COTA NSW webinar looks at ways you can reduce your energy bills without sweltering over the summer months. It will help you think through things you can change around your home to reduce costs, and give you a range of questions to ask providers to make sure you're getting the best deal.

Webinar – Launch of 50+ Report “Dignity, Respect, Choice: Planning for the Final Chapter”

Watch the engaging and informative launch of our 2020 50+ report, which looks at the levels of knowledge and usage of the legal instruments available to people that ensures their future legal, health and financial decisions are enacted towards the end of their life.

Living Longer Living Stronger Videos

We encourage you to join a Living Longer Living Stronger class if possible. If you can’t, you can use these videos made by COTA Victoria featuring Living Longer Living Stronger instructors. They include ideas on how to make exercise equipment from ordinary household objects.

Active Ageing Exercise Videos

COTA ACT’s Active Ageing videos support older people to safely improve their health, strength, balance and fitness.
